Have you tried giving Katie Lysine chews or paste? It boosts their immune system specifically against recurring URIs. One of our cats has the rhino virus and used to break out in hives and get URIs at any sign of stress. Since he's been on Lysine, his outbreaks have been cut back by 90%. He still gets the occasional cold, like after a vet visit, but it's now once a year instead of once a month.
